#dba194 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dba194 is composed of 85.9% red, 63.1%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.5% magenta, 32.4%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 11 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 72%. #dba194 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b74329.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#dba194
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0504 is the darkest color, while #fefb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#dba194
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bab6b5 is the less saturated color, while #fc8c73 is the most saturated one.
